Abstract
It combines Finite Element Analysis(FEA) with modal test. Firstly we analyze the modal characteristics of the structure with FEA, then test the natural frequency of the structure by experiments to check the reliability of FEA method. We can optimize the design by modifying certain parameters of the structure and analyzing the corresponding dynamic characteristics.
